Faith and Community Empowerment Formerly Korean Churches for Community Development Review
Faith and Community Empowerment (FACE), formerly Korean Churches for Community Development, is a Los Angeles-based non-profit established to advance Asian American community participation and economic mobility through faith partnerships and community development. Operating from their Wilshire Boulevard office, FACE has evolved into a comprehensive community resource organization serving thousands of families across multiple financial and social domains.
FACE offers concrete financial assistance and educational services including homeownership programs with down payment assistance, foreclosure prevention support totaling $92M in mortgages saved, and sub-grants ($400K+) distributed to faith-based and community organizations. They provide free training and guidance to faith leaders on community development, serve as a resource connector between the Asian American community and broader institutions, and facilitate youth development and community building initiatives. Their homeownership focus includes providing tools and resources to help low-income families achieve home ownership, with 12,000+ families supported to date.
FACE distinguishes itself through its specific focus on Asian American community inclusion and visibility in policy advocacy, leveraging an extensive network of 800+ community partners and 5,000+ trained faith leaders. Their dual approach combines direct financial assistance with systemic advocacy work, positioning themselves as a bridge between underrepresented communities and institutional resources including the White House and Fortune 500 companies. The organization's faith-based framework differentiates it from secular non-profits, integrating spiritual values with practical economic empowerment.
As a free-help non-profit, FACE represents legitimate community support without predatory lending or hidden fees. However, their website does not detail specific eligibility requirements, application timelines, or availability of services by geography, which may limit accessibility information for prospective clients. The scope of their services is broad but may require direct contact to determine specific program applicability to individual circumstances.
